Letter to the Editor: Folk for State Representative

As a 35 year resident of Simsbury and an owner of a small business, I am pleased to see that we will have Charity Folk running for the 16th District State Representative.  We need a person who believes in a balanced budget and limiting expenditures beyond what we can afford. 

In voting for Charity, Simsbury has a great opportunity to bring real business sense to the State Legislature rather than the same old ideas from another career politician.  Charity has always advocated for Simsbury's interests in her 25 years at our Chamber of Commerce and now we can elect her to a State leadership role. 

She understands the issues facing the citizens of the town and she will focus her efforts on working with us to address them.  Charity understands that government is the problem and not the solution.  Someone who will promote a small business owner friendly climate by advocating for less regulation and lower taxes is what Simsbury and our state legislature needs and Charity Folk is who I will be voting for on November 6 for the 16th District State Representative.
